// MAX_BACKTRACK_DEPTH: hard cap on the Slotwright solver's
// backtracking when placing double-period science blocks.
// Raising this past 40 blows up runtime on the Hollybrook
// Academy dataset; lowering it leaves gaps in Friday slots.
// Do not change without rerunning the timetable regression
// suite. Last validated on the build noted here:

session token of yajof-bagef = htk4_937d

// USER_SERVICE_CUTOVER_RATIO
// Controls traffic split between the legacy Hollowmere monolith's user
// module and the extracted Wrenfold user service. Raise only in 0.05
// increments; each bump requires a clean hour of error-rate parity.
// If Wrenfold misbehaves, set to 0.0 — the monolith path is still fully
// functional. Do not delete the legacy handlers until this constant
// has held at 1.0 for two full weeks. The ratio was last changed in
// the build whose token is recorded below.

trace token, kahog-tajeg: htk6_97d963

## Recovery: Coldhollow Archive Buckets

Applies when the archive service account is locked and scheduled bucket freezes are failing.

1. Confirm lockout in the audit log — look for three failed rotations.
2. Pause the freeze scheduler. Do not let it retry; retries extend the lockout.
3. Open the recovery console from the bastion host only.
4. Verify the bucket manifest checksum against last night's snapshot.
5. If checksums match, proceed; if not, escalate to the archive owner.

At the console prompt, enter the recovery passphrase shown below.

strongbox words: sorir-belvan-rusix-ulays-ralmir-praix-eliir-tamax-praael-druael-julir-tamius-jorir

Subject: Payroll export format change — action needed

Hello Corvane integration team,

As of the next cycle, Wrenfield payroll exports switch from fixed-width to delimited files with a header row. Field order is unchanged; two new columns (cost centre, accrual code) are appended. Since you're new to this feed, please run a dry import against our sandbox before go-live and confirm totals match. Sandbox requests must carry the bearer token below.

session JWT of yawep-yawep = eyJhbGciOiJIUzI1NiIsInR5cCI6IkpXVCJ9.eyJzdWIiOiI3pWF3_In0.aXYsHiog